Comment convertir des fichiers XLT en JPG avec GroupDocs.Conversion pour .NET
Dans l’espace de travail numérique actuel, une conversion efficace des formats de fichiers est essentielle pour gérer et partager les données entre plateformes. Ce tutoriel vous guide dans l’utilisation de GroupDocs.Conversion pour .NET afin de convertir des fichiers de modèles Excel (XLT) en images JPG, améliorant ainsi l’accessibilité et l’efficacité de la distribution.
Ce que vous apprendrez :
- Configurer votre environnement avec GroupDocs.Conversion
- Mise en œuvre étape par étape de la conversion XLT en JPG
- Options de configuration clés et considérations de performances
Prérequis
Avant de commencer le processus de conversion, assurez-vous d’avoir :
Bibliothèques et versions requises
- GroupDocs.Conversion pour .NET:Version 25.3.0 ou ultérieure.
Configuration requise pour l’environnement
- Visual Studio (2019 ou version ultérieure) installé sur votre machine.
- Compréhension de base du langage de programmation C#.
Prérequis en matière de connaissances
- Connaissance de la gestion des fichiers dans les applications .NET.
- Compréhension des concepts de conversion de fichiers.
Configuration de GroupDocs.Conversion pour .NET
Installez la bibliothèque nécessaire à l’aide de la console du gestionnaire de packages NuGet ou de l’interface de ligne de commande .NET :
Console du gestionnaire de packages NuGet
Install-Package GroupDocs.Conversion -Version 25.3.0
.NET CLI
dotnet add package GroupDocs.Conversion --version 25.3.0
Étapes d’acquisition de licence
- Essai gratuitCommencez par un essai gratuit pour explorer les fonctionnalités.
- Licence temporaire:Obtenez une licence temporaire pour des tests prolongés.
- Achat: Achetez une licence complète si vous êtes satisfait, pour une utilisation en production.
Initialisation et configuration de base
Initialisez GroupDocs.Conversion dans votre projet C# :
using System;
using GroupDocs.Conversion;
class Program
{
static void Main()
{
// Remplacez par le chemin d'accès à votre fichier XLT
string xltFilePath = "YOUR_DOCUMENT_DIRECTORY/sample.xlt";
using (Converter converter = new Converter(xltFilePath))
{
Console.WriteLine("File loaded successfully for conversion.");
}
}
}
Guide de mise en œuvre
Charger le fichier XLT
Aperçu: Commencez par charger le fichier XLT dans un Converter
objet.
Mise en œuvre étape par étape :
- Créer un objet convertisseur
using (Converter converter = new Converter(xltFilePath)) { // Le convertisseur conserve désormais le fichier XLT pour traitement. }
- Expliquer les paramètres et le but:
xltFilePath
: Chemin vers votre fichier XLT source.Converter
objet : Gère les processus de chargement et de conversion.
Définir les options de conversion
Aperçu: Définissez les paramètres de conversion, en les configurant spécifiquement pour convertir au format JPG.
Mise en œuvre étape par étape :
- Définir les options de conversion d’image
using GroupDocs.Conversion.Options.Convert; // Spécifiez le format cible comme JPG ImageConvertOptions jpgOptions = new ImageConvertOptions { Format = GroupDocs.Conversion.FileTypes.ImageFileType.Jpg };
- Configuration des clés:
ImageConvertOptions
: Configure les paramètres de conversion.Format
: Définit le type de fichier de sortie, dans ce cas, JPG.
Convertir XLT en JPG
Aperçu: Exécutez la conversion de XLT en une série d’images JPG à l’aide d’options et de chemins définis.
Mise en œuvre étape par étape :
- Charger le fichier XLT
using (Converter converter = new GroupDocs.Conversion.Converter("YOUR_DOCUMENT_DIRECTORY/sample.xlt")) { // La logique de conversion sera ajoutée ici. }
- Définir les options de conversion et effectuer la conversion
string outputFolder = "YOUR_OUTPUT_DIRECTORY"; string outputFileTemplate = Path.Combine(outputFolder, "converted-page-{0}.jpg"); Func<SavePageContext, Stream> getPageStream = savePageContext => new FileStream(string.Format(outputFileTemplate, savePageContext.Page), FileMode.Create); converter.Convert(getPageStream, jpgOptions);
- Expliquer les paramètres et le but de la méthode:
outputFolder
: Répertoire où les fichiers JPG seront enregistrés.getPageStream
:Fonction permettant de gérer le flux de sortie de chaque page pendant la conversion.
Applications pratiques
- Rapports financiers:Convertissez des modèles financiers en images partageables pour des présentations ou des partages avec des clients.
- Systèmes de gestion de documents: Automatisez les conversions de formats de fichiers dans les flux de travail, améliorant ainsi l’accessibilité et l’efficacité.
- Plateformes de partage de données:Simplifiez le processus de conversion de documents complexes en un format d’image universellement accessible.
Considérations relatives aux performances
- Optimiser l’utilisation des ressources: Convertissez les fichiers pendant les heures creuses pour optimiser les performances du serveur.
- Gestion de la mémoire: Assurez une élimination appropriée des flux et des objets pour éviter les fuites de mémoire, en particulier dans les tâches de conversion à volume élevé.
Conclusion
En suivant ce guide, vous avez appris à configurer GroupDocs.Conversion pour .NET et à convertir des fichiers XLT en images JPG. Cette compétence est essentielle pour diverses applications telles que les systèmes de reporting financier ou de gestion documentaire.
Prochaines étapes
- Expérimentez la conversion de différents formats de fichiers en suivant des étapes similaires.
- Explorez les fonctionnalités supplémentaires de GroupDocs.Conversion pour améliorer les fonctionnalités de votre application.
Section FAQ
- Quel est le principal cas d’utilisation de la conversion de fichiers XLT en JPG ?
- La conversion des fichiers XLT en JPG rend les modèles financiers facilement partageables dans des formats visuels, idéaux pour les présentations et le partage avec les parties prenantes qui préfèrent les images aux feuilles de calcul.
- Puis-je convertir plusieurs pages d’un fichier XLT en fichiers JPG distincts ?
- Oui, le processus de conversion peut gérer chaque page comme une image JPG distincte à l’aide du
getPageStream
fonction.
- Oui, le processus de conversion peut gérer chaque page comme une image JPG distincte à l’aide du
- Que dois-je faire si les images converties ne sont pas dans la résolution souhaitée ?
- Ajustez votre
ImageConvertOptions
pour spécifier différentes résolutions ou dimensions avant la conversion.
- Ajustez votre
- GroupDocs.Conversion est-il compatible avec d’autres frameworks .NET ?
- Oui, il est compatible avec différentes versions de .NET et peut être intégré dans une large gamme d’applications .NET.
- Comment résoudre les erreurs lors du processus de conversion ?
- Vérifiez vos chemins de fichiers, assurez-vous que toutes les bibliothèques nécessaires sont correctement installées et reportez-vous à la documentation GroupDocs.Conversion pour les messages d’erreur et les solutions spécifiques.
Ressources
Lancez-vous dans votre voyage vers une conversion de fichiers efficace avec GroupDocs.Conversion pour .NET et explorez ses capacités robustes dès aujourd’hui !